اموزش Data base و اصول طراحی آن
عنوان دوره: آموزش پایگاه داده (Database) و اصول طراحی آن
ضرورت و اهمیت دوره:
با توجه به گسترش روزافزون اطلاعات و اهمیت مدیریت آنها، تسلط بر مفاهیم پایگاه داده و طراحی آن از مهارتهای حیاتی برای هر برنامهنویس و تحلیلگر داده است. اصول طراحی صحیح پایگاه داده میتواند تاثیر مستقیمی بر عملکرد سیستمها و ذخیرهسازی دادهها داشته باشد. این دوره به شرکتکنندگان کمک میکند تا مفاهیم پایه و پیشرفته طراحی پایگاه داده را بیاموزند و از این مهارتها در پروژههای عملی و شغلی خود استفاده کنند.
از کاربردهای اصلی این دوره میتوان به طراحی و پیادهسازی سیستمهای اطلاعاتی، مدیریت دادهها و بهینهسازی عملکرد پایگاه داده اشاره کرد
سرفصل دوره:
- جلسه 1: معرفی پایگاه دادهها و مفاهیم اولیه
مباحث: آشنایی با مفهوم پایگاه داده، سیستمهای مدیریت پایگاه داده (DBMS)، مزایای استفاده از پایگاه داده، انواع پایگاه دادهها (رابطهای، غیررابطهای).
- جلسه 2: مدلسازی دادهها و طراحی مفهومی
مباحث: مدل موجودیت-رابطه (ER)، شناسایی موجودیتها و روابط، تعیین ویژگیها، طراحی نمودار ER (Entity-Relationship).
- جلسه 3: تبدیل مدل ER به جداول رابطهای
مباحث: تبدیل نمودار ER به جداول، تعیین کلیدهای اصلی و خارجی، تعیین ارتباطات بین جداول.
- جلسه 4: نرمالسازی پایگاه داده
مباحث: اصول نرمالسازی، فرمهای نرمال (1NF، 2NF، 3NF)، جلوگیری از تکرار دادهها و بهبود کارایی.
- جلسه 5: آشنایی با زبان SQL و پیادهسازی جداول
مباحث: تعریف SQL، ایجاد و مدیریت جداول با دستورات SQL، اصول طراحی جداول، استفاده از دستورات CREATE، ALTER، DROP.
- جلسه 6: مدیریت دادهها با SQL (عملیات درج، بهروزرسانی، حذف)
مباحث: دستورهای INSERT، UPDATE، DELETE، مدیریت دادههای ورودی و خروجی، بهینهسازی دسترسی به دادهها.
- جلسه 7: طراحی و پیادهسازی شاخصها (Indexes) و بهبود کارایی
مباحث: معرفی شاخصها، انواع شاخصها، ایجاد و استفاده از شاخصها برای بهینهسازی پایگاه داده.
- جلسه 8: امنیت و مدیریت دسترسی در پایگاه داده
مباحث: اصول امنیتی در پایگاه داده، مدیریت کاربران و سطوح دسترسی، پشتیبانگیری و بازیابی اطلاعات.
- جلسه 9: طراحی و پیادهسازی پروژه نهایی
مباحث: انجام پروژه عملی طراحی پایگاه داده کامل، پیادهسازی مراحل از طراحی مفهومی تا اجرا و بهینهسازی.
مخاطبان دوره:
- دانشجویان و فارغالتحصیلان رشتههای کامپیوتر، فناوری اطلاعات و مهندسی نرمافزار.
- برنامهنویسان و توسعهدهندگان نرمافزار که به دنبال تسلط بر طراحی و مدیریت پایگاه داده هستند.
- مدیران سیستمها و تحلیلگران داده که قصد بهبود ساختار پایگاه دادههای موجود را دارند.
- علاقهمندان به یادگیری اصول طراحی پایگاه دادههای رابطهای و غیررابطهای.
برنامه و زمانبندی دوره:
۶۰ ساعت
تقویم جلسات:
- هفته 1: آشنایی با پایگاه دادهها و مدلسازی دادهها.
- هفته 2: تبدیل مدلهای مفهومی به جداول و نرمالسازی.
- هفته 3: کار با SQL و پیادهسازی جداول.
- هفته 4: بهینهسازی و امنیت پایگاه داده.
- هفته 5: انجام پروژه نهایی و ارائه آن.
شرایط شرکت در دوره:
- گذراندن دوره مقدمه ای بر الگوریتم و برنامه نویسی
- آشنایی ابتدایی با کامپیوتر و برنامهنویسی.
- داشتن یک سیستم کامپیوتری برای پیادهسازی عملی پروژهها.
- تکمیل فرم ثبتنام و پرداخت هزینه دوره.
- حضور مستمر و شرکت فعال در جلسات و انجام پروژه نهایی.
گذراندن دوره مقدمه ای بر الگوریتم و برنامه نویسی - - داشتن یک سیستم کامپیوتری شخصی یا لپتاپ برای تمرینهای دوره توصیه میشود.
- این مدرک دارای QR Code و مهر اصلی دانشگاه است و از طریق سایت دانشگاه قابل استعلام می باشد.
- هزینه شرکت در این دوره برای شرکت کنندگان ریال می باشد و این مبلغ تنها برای دوره جاری معتبر می باشد.
مشاوره و پیش ثبت نام:
جهت کسب اطلاعات دقیقتر و جزئیات بیشتر راجع به دوره، فرم زیر را تکمیل نمایید تا مشاوران ما با شما تماس بگیرند.